#bd8a1b - RGB(189, 138, 27) - Geebung Color FAQ
Hex color code for Geebung color is #bd8a1b. RGB color code for geebung color is rgb(189, 138, 27).
The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#bd8a1b is rgb(189, 138, 27).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'189' indicates the intensity of the red component, '138' represents the green component's intensity, and '27'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#bd8a1b.
The RGB percentage composition for the hexadecimal color code #bd8a1b is detailed as follows: 74.1% Red, 54.1% Green, and 10.6% Blue. This breakdown indicates the relative contribution of each primary color in the RGB color model to achieve this specific shade. The value 74.1% for Red signifies a dominant red component, contributing significantly to the overall color. The Green and Blue components are comparatively lower, with 54.1% and 10.6% respectively, playing a smaller role in the composition of this particular hue. Together, these percentages of Red, Green, and Blue mix to form the distinct color represented by #bd8a1b.

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#bd8a1b is composed of 0% Cyan, 27% Magenta, 86% Yellow, and 26%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 27%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 86%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 26%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
